Book Description:

Hold It! You should know that: Walking is not one of the best exercises and will never get you fit For certain body types, stair climbers will not trim your thighs and buttocks or give you slim hips You do not need expensive health club memberships to become fit You do not need to exercise for more than an hour a day to lose weight or increase your fitness level Hold It! You're Exercising Wrong analyzes popular exercise techniques and explains why they do or do not work. Using his client-proven methods of fitness, Edward Jackowski renames body types and stresses their importance when choosing an exercise routine, details the four essential phases of any workout, lists the best exercises for weight loss, and provides motivational techniques to keep you going. Interspersing more than 150 tips on health and exercise, Hold It! You're Exercising Wrong is a no-nonsense, all-you-need-to-know guide to getting fit and staying that way.
